The Surgical Devices market is a segment of the medical device industry that produces and sells products used in surgical procedures. These products range from simple tools such as scalpels and forceps to complex robotic systems. The market is driven by advances in technology, the need for minimally invasive procedures, and the increasing demand for better patient outcomes.
The market is divided into two main categories: consumables and capital equipment. Consumables are disposable items such as sutures, drapes, and gloves, while capital equipment includes items such as surgical instruments, imaging systems, and robotic systems.
Some of the major players in the Surgical Devices market include Johnson & Johnson, Medtronic, Stryker, B. Braun, and Zimmer Biomet. These companies are involved in the development, manufacturing, and distribution of a wide range of surgical devices.
